Wolves boss O'Neil ponders Euro push

Wolves are now being spoken of as possible contenders for a European spot.

The Molineux Stadium team are experiencing a remarkable turnaround since the start of the season.

When Gary O'Neil took charge days before their opening game, most pundits predicted that Wolves would go down.

O'Neil prefers to praise his players, stating after a 4-2 win over Chelsea: “We are a small group but the quality of player the club has managed to recruit before I was here, then me being able to come in and help their understanding, is the reason we are producing the results we are.

“There is no magic wand. They are good players in the dressing room.

Joao Gomes being signed at a young age, Matheus Cunha, Mario Lemina last January, Craig Dawson at the same time. Pedro Neto whenever that was. It is not like I have turned bad players into good ones.

“There are some extremely talented players who all understand now what we are trying to do."
